Biscuits and Gravy Casserole with Sausage and Eggs

  1. Preheat the Oven:
    • Start by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ease a 9×13 inch baking dish with cooking spray or a little oil to prevent sticking.
  2. Cook the Sausage:
    • In a large skillet over medium-high heat, cook the sausage, breaking it up with a spatula, until it is browned and cooked through. This should take about 6-8 minutes. Once cooked, drain any excess fat from the skillet.
  3. Prepare the Gravy:
    • In a medium bowl, whisk together the gravy mix and 1 cup of water until smooth. Add the gravy mixture to the skillet with the cooked sausage. Stir to combine and let it simmer for 2-3 minutes, until the gravy has thickened.
  4. Add Cheese to the Gravy:
    • Remove the skillet from the heat and stir in the shredded cheddar cheese until it is melted and fully combined with the sausage gravy mixture. This adds a creamy, cheesy richness to the casserole.
  5. Prepare the Egg Mixture:
    • In a separate b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, salt, and black pepper. This will form the base that binds the casserole together and adds a fluffy texture.
  6. Assemble the Casserole:
    • Spread the sausage gravy mixture evenly into the prepared baking dish. Pour the egg mixture over the top, ensuring it covers the sausage gravy evenly.
  7. Add the Biscuits:
    • Open the can of Pillsbury Grands Biscuits and cut each biscuit into quarters. Place the biscuit pieces on top of the egg mixture, distributing them evenly across the dish. The biscuits will bake up golden brown and delicious, providing a fluffy topping for the casserole.
  8. Bake:
    • Bake the casserole in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the biscuits are golden brown and the eggs are set. You can check for doneness by inserting a knife into the center; if it comes out clean, the casserole is ready.
  9. Serve:
    • Once baked, let the casserole cool for a few minutes before serving. This will make it easier to slice and serve. Enjoy it warm, and watch it disappear as everyone digs in!

Tips for a Perfect Biscuits and Gravy Casserole:

  • Customize Your Sausage: Feel free to use your favorite type of sausage. Spicy, mild, or even turkey sausage can add a unique twist to the dish.
  • Extra Veggies: For a nutritious boost, consider adding sautéed vegetables like bell peppers, onions, or spinach to the sausage gravy mixture.
  • Cheese Options: While cheddar cheese is a classic choice, you can experiment with other types like mozzarella, pepper jack, or Colby for different flavor profiles.
  • Make-Ahead Option: This casserole can be assembled the night before and stored in the refrigerator. In the morning, simply bake it as directed for a hassle-free breakfast.
